Why Recycled Polypropylene Plastic Pads Are the Ideal Choice for Modern Packaging and Protection
In today's global supply chains and industrial operations, the need for reliable, cost-effective, and environmentally responsible protective packaging has never been greater. One product that consistently meets this critical demand is the recycled polypropylene (PP) plastic pad. Often referred to as a layer pad, slip sheet, or divider pad, this simple yet ingeniously effective component plays a pivotal role in stabilizing and protecting goods during storage and transit. Crafted from durable corrugated plastic, these pads are specifically engineered to absorb shock, distribute weight evenly, and prevent surface damage. What truly sets the modern version apart is its composition—increasingly manufactured from 100% recycled PP material. This key feature transforms it from a mere utility item into a cornerstone of sustainable logistics, offering businesses a powerful way to enhance operational efficiency while demonstrably reducing their environmental footprint.

The primary and most immediate function of recycled PP plastic pads is to provide superior protection for valuable products. Placed between layers of goods on a pallet—such as boxes, bags, metal parts, glass panels, or furniture—they create a stable, non-slip barrier. This prevents items from shifting, rubbing against each other, or collapsing during the rigors of transportation, which includes forklift handling, truck vibrations, and stacking in warehouses. The corrugated fluted structure of the pad acts as a cushion, absorbing impacts and dispersing pressure points that could otherwise cause dents, scratches, or breakage. Unlike cardboard or paper dividers that can compress, tear, or lose integrity when exposed to moisture, polypropylene is inherently waterproof, resistant to oils and chemicals, and maintains its strength in humid conditions. This durability ensures that products arrive at their destination in the same pristine condition they left the factory, minimizing costly returns, warranty claims, and waste from damaged goods.
Beyond their protective role, recycled PP plastic pads deliver exceptional operational and economic advantages. Their lightweight nature is a significant benefit; they add minimal weight to a shipment compared to wooden spacers or heavier alternatives, which can lead to substantial savings on fuel and transportation costs over thousands of shipments. Their uniform thickness and consistent quality allow for perfect stacking, maximizing the use of vertical space in containers and storage facilities. This optimized cube utilization translates directly to lower storage and shipping costs per unit. Furthermore, their durability makes them inherently reusable. A single plastic pad can make dozens or even hundreds of trips through a closed-loop system before needing replacement, whereas single-use materials like cardboard must be continually repurchased and disposed of. This reusability creates a powerful cycle of cost reduction, slashing long-term expenditure on packaging materials and waste management.
The most compelling and contemporary benefit of these pads is their outstanding environmental profile, rooted in the use of recycled polypropylene. By utilizing post-consumer or post-industrial plastic waste as their raw material, these pads actively divert tons of plastic from landfills and oceans. This manufacturing process requires significantly less energy and water than producing virgin plastic, thereby conserving natural resources and reducing greenhouse gas emissions. When a pad reaches the end of its long service life after years of reuse, the material's journey does not end. The polypropylene is itself 100% recyclable, meaning it can be collected, processed, and remanufactured into new pads or other plastic products, supporting a genuine circular economy. The versatility of recycled PP plastic pads is evident in their wide range of applications across diverse industries. In the food and beverage sector, their waterproof and easy-to-clean surface makes them ideal for separating layers of canned goods, bottles, or packaged foods. The manufacturing and automotive industries rely on them to protect delicate machine parts, sheet metal, and painted components. In agriculture, they are used to stabilize pallets of bagged fertilizer or seed. Retailers and distributors use them for storing and shipping non-food consumer goods. Their design can also be customized; they can be produced in any size or thickness to fit specific pallet dimensions or load requirements, and they can be easily cut on-site to accommodate irregular shapes. Some versions even incorporate anti-static properties for protecting sensitive electronics.
